A Bay Area Warriors update

Coach Randy Bessolo recently provided an update on his Bay Area Warriors squad:

We will be playing in 3 NCAA sanctioned events in July.

* 7/14-15 Gerry Freitas' NorCal Hoop Review event at CiCSF

* 7/18-22 at the Pump's Best of the Summer event in Anaheim

* 7//26-29 at the Fab 48 tournament in Las Vegas

We have had 14 players go D-I from our program the last six years and many more go D-II, D-III and JUCO.

Here are some of the guys from the Class of 2013 who are playing on my Bay Area Warriors Club Team.  

* Kenny Love, Cardinal Newman, 6-foot-1 combo guard - Kenny can really score a lot of different ways. He was first-team all-NBL and has been receiving D-1 interest from several schools

* Jeremy Dennis, St. Mary's Berkeley, 6-foot-4 combo guard - Jeremy can score and has good size and athleticism for a guard. He is a D-I athlete, was first team all-BSAL and scored 25 vs. Salesian.

* Harold Getz, University, 6-foot-3 combo guard - Harold shows great handles and the ability to get to the rim for a big guard. He is on my high school and was a first-team all-league pick and a Chronicle All-Metro honorable mention. We have heard from a couple D-Is.

* Jacqui Biggins, Serra, 6-foot-1 shooting guard - A super shooter, Jacqui scored 27 on the Oakland Soldiers last weekend including seven three-pointers. He has received limited interest from D-Is but will get looks.

* Owen Putz, Half Moon Bay, 6-foot-9 - Owen is getting more skilled and athletic every day. He'll get D-I looks based on his size but is a bit of a project.

* Samson Donnick, Redwood, 6-foot-1 guard - Samson is strong and tough with good skills.

* Chris Mah, University, 5-foot-11 point guard - Another one of my high school guys who is fast and with real strong ball-handling skills and feel for the game. He set the University single season assist record with 195 this year and was both first-team all-league and and runner-up for player of the year in our league. Chris started on the team that went to the State Final Four a year ago and State Sweet 16 this year.

* Kevin Murray, Mission, 5-foot-10 - A real quick guard with super handles who can score.

* Al Waters, St. Ignatius, 5-foot-10 - A classic point guard and super competitor, he is getting low-level D-1 football recruiting interest.

* Jared Nodar, St. Mary's, 6-foot-5, forward (class of 2014).  Jared can play inside or on perimeter.
